Brake Pad Wear and Replacement



When it involves preserving your automobile's brake system, one critical element to keep an eye on is the wear and substitute of brake pads. Brake pads are essential components that push against the brake rotors to slow down or quit your vehicle. With time, these pads wear down due to friction, requiring routine evaluation and replacement to guarantee your brakes operate effectively.

To figure out if your brake pads need replacement, pay attention for screeching or grinding sounds when you use the brakes. Furthermore, if your car takes longer to stop or you see vibrations or pulsations when stopping, it might be time to change the brake pads.

Neglecting worn brake pads can lead to reduced stopping performance, damages to various other brake parts, or perhaps brake failing.

Changing brake pads is a relatively straightforward procedure for several vehicles. However, if you're not sure or uncomfortable performing this task, it's finest to consult a specialist auto mechanic to ensure proper installment and optimal brake efficiency.

Routinely examining and replacing brake pads is important for your security and the longevity of your car's braking system.

Brake Liquid Leaks and Upkeep



To ensure your lorry's brake system operates efficiently, it's important to likewise take note of brake fluid leakages and maintenance. Brake fluid is important for transferring the force from your foot on the brake pedal to the real braking device. One common problem with brake fluid is leakages, which can happen as a result of scrubby brake lines, seals, or connections. If you observe a pool or drips under your car, it's essential to resolve the leak promptly to avoid a potential brake failure.

Spongy Brake Pedal: Bleeding Brakes



If you have actually ever experienced a spongy brake pedal while driving, you comprehend the value of preserving a firm and receptive braking system. One common reason for a mushy brake pedal is air trapped in the brake lines. When air goes into the brake system, it can result in a loss of hydraulic pressure, leading to that disturbing squishy feeling when you push the brake pedal.

To hemorrhage the brakes, you'll require an assistant to assist you. Beginning by finding the brake bleeder valve on each wheel, commonly located near the brake caliper. With a wrench, loosen the shutoff and have your assistant press the brake pedal while you observe any air bubbles coming out. Repeat this procedure for each wheel, starting from the wheel farthest from the master cyndrical tube and relocating more detailed.



As soon as you no longer see air bubbles and just clear fluid arises, tighten the valve and top up the brake liquid reservoir as needed. Bleeding the brakes helps make certain a company brake pedal and boosts overall braking efficiency.
